Draft opinion Paragraph 1 1. Underlines that despite the progress that resulted from the 2011 budgetary reserve, the Commission has so far failed to alter the horizontal rules for EGs and their practices in a way that would meet Parliament’s requests for transparency, and that the number of EGs in which there is an imbalance has increased
Amendment 5 #
Draft opinion Paragraph 1 a (new) 1 a. Points out, in this context, and with regard to par. 34-45 of the Ombudsman's aforementioned opinion, that, although the Comission has not yet formally defined its concept of 'balance', the latter is not to be understood as the result of an arithmetic exercise, but rather as the result of efforts to ensure that the members of an EG, together, possess the necessary technical expertise and breadth of perspectives to deliver on the mandate of the EG in question; finds that the concept of balance should, therefore, be understood as tied to the specific mandate of each single EG; considers that the criteria to assess whether an EG is balanced should include the tasks of the group, the technical expertise required, the stakeholders who would be most likely affected by the matter, the organisation of groups of stakeholders, and the appropriate ratio of economic and non- economic interests;

Amendment 7 #
Draft opinion Paragraph 1 c (new) 1 c. Welcomes the Commission's public announcement that the revised framework for EGs will take up a number of Parliament's and the Ombudsman's suggestions, such as mandatory open calls for application, an improved register, mandatory registration in the Transparency Register for stakeholder representatives, a definition, for each EG, of the profiles needed to ensure a balanced composition, as well as mandatory declarations on conflicts of interest, which will be put on the register;
Amendment 8 #
Draft opinion Paragraph 1 d (new) 1 d. Urges the Commission to implement, moreover, the Ombudsman's recommendations on transparency, namely, that the agendas, background documents and minutes of EG meetings should be published, unless, in exceptional cases and with the Commission's consent, a majority of members decides otherwise, and that the published minutes should be as meaningful as possible and set out the positions expressed by the members;
